Abstract
This invention relates to pyridyl derivatives of the formula ##STR1## wherein X, Y, A, n and R.sub.3 to R.sub.8 are defined hereinbelow, the enantiomers thereof, the cis- and trans-isomers thereof, which have antithrombotic pharmaceutical activity.
